2010-02-26 - AutoQA resultdb design discussion (part#2)
by James Laska
# AutoQA ResultsDB Discussion
# Date: 2010-02-26
# Time: 15:00 UTC (10:00 EST, 16:00 CET)
# Participants - wwoods, jlaska, kparal, jskladan
= Review definition/goals =
https://fedorahosted.org/pipermail/autoqa-devel/2010-February/000201.html
Goals
* One central database to store test results (audience QA)
* Multiple front-ends to present stored results (audience QA/developers)
= Recap of research =
* Overview - https://fedoraproject.org/wiki/AutoQA_resultsdb_approaches
Spikesource schema -
http://dev.spikesource.com/wiki/index.php/Trpi-schema_view
* No concept of WAIVE results
RHTS/Beaker - http://beaker.fedorahosted.org/
* stores log files directly
* presents most important data on main results page (e.g. stdout)
* Hiearchy - Job contains RecipeSet(s), which contains Recipe(s), which
contains test(s), which contain phase(s)
Beakerlib
* Allows specification of test phases
* Provides common test writing format in bash
* beakerlib xml journal
http://jskladan.fedorapeople.org/beakerlib_format.xml
** test which produced the output:
http://git.fedorahosted.org/git/?p=autoqa.git;a=blob;f=tests/beakerlib_in...
RATS
* Test results linked by a unique key (timestamp of tree being tested)
* install.py test also uses concept of "phases" -
http://git.fedorahosted.org/git/?p=autoqa.git;a=blob;f=tests/rats_install...
* Multiple tests (2), each with multiple phases - Viewed from single
location - http://jlaska.fedorapeople.org/rats.png
= Ideate =
* Define an output standard for each test type for easier inspection of
results (similar to beakerlib)
* TCMS - something we're gonna forget about for now (db scheme review in
'open topics')
= Terminology =
* test case - one unit with a single result (but may contain several
phases)
* test phase - parts of a test case, their results are not stored
separately in the results db, but define pass/fail result of the test
case itself (internally for the test)
* test plan - contains several test cases, provides meta data around
test cases (responsibility, workflow, high-level criteria etc...)
* mapping to the beakerlib_format.xml - depends on particular test, for
initscripts checking: <log> ~ test case, <phase> ~ test phase
= Open topics =
* How to handle policy (waive) in tools?
** https://fedoraproject.org/wiki/AutoQA_resultsdb_approaches#DB_schema
- rpmdiff solution
* Is defining a common test writing and output format the same as
providing a results front-end/workflow?
* Examine nitrate/testopia resultsdb format?
* Test case results vs autotest job results (unhandled exception, etc)
= Tasks =
* [wwoods] - Examine beakerlib output format if it is sufficient for our
purposes
* [jlaska] - Examine nitrate/testopia DB schema
* [kparal + jskladan] - Define personas and write use cases
Example:
https://fedoraproject.org/wiki/No_frozen_rawhide_announce_plan#Use_Cases
Wiki page: https://fedoraproject.org/wiki/AutoQA_resultsdb_use_cases
* [kparal + jskladan] - Propose some initial DB schema
= Next Meeting =
* 2010-03-05 - mailing list checkin (conference call if needed)

Increase the default guest RAM size and add command-line tunable
by James Laska
Greetings,
>From bug#559290, it's looking more like 512M for an x86_64 install is not sufficient. While that discovery process is underway, I'd like to increase the default guest RAM size from 512 to 768. Additionally, I found that being able to change this value from the command-line was very helpful. The following patch add a command-line argument to install.py to support changing the RAM size of the guest.
Comments/concerns appreciated.
